What is Lo about?

Lo is a documentary. Thanassis Vassiliou returns to his childhood apartment in Athens after his mother's death. He confronts the inheritance left behind. The film details his reflections on the Greek Junta from 1967 to 1974 and its effects on his family. Personal grief intertwines with the national trauma experienced during this period. Vassiliou uses empty spaces from his past to understand how history shapes individual legacies and the weight of loss in his life. The documentary runs for 70 minutes and is produced in Greece and France.
